Before you start renting out your truck, it’s important to do some research and understand the local market. Different cities have their unique truck rental needs, from long-term leasing of box trucks to one-off deliveries of pickup trucks.
Also, research the different rental services available in your area. South Africa offers a wide range of truck rental options, from traditional rental services to on-demand hauling apps. Each of these services offer different features and benefits, so it pays to understand what you’d be getting into before diving into the market.
Finally, be sure to familiarize yourself with local regulations. South Africa takes truck rental very seriously, and all transactions must abide by the law. Knowing the relevant laws and regulations, and your responsibilities as a rental provider will help you remain safe and protect your interests as you rent out your truck.
Now that you know the basics of renting out your truck in South Africa, it’s time to get your vehicle ready. For starters, check the truck for any signs of damage or wear and tear. Make sure it meets the legal requirements of a rental truck, such as having a valid roadworthy certificate and a valid license plate.
Also, it’s important that you inspect the truck for any safety hazards, such as worn out brake pads and bald tires. If there are any issues with the truck, fix them immediately before renting out your vehicle.
You’ll also want to ensure you have all the necessary paperwork in order. Create rental contracts that clearly outline the policies, terms, and conditions of the rental transaction. You should also have proof of ownership for the vehicle, as well as photographic evidence of the condition the truck was in before handing it over for the rental.
Finally, consider basic preventive maintenance. Get the oil changed and the truck tuned up before it heads out on the road. This not only keeps you safe but also helps to ensure that the truck stays in good condition while it’s being rented out.
